Q

Is one of the specialty division of
civil engineering which deals with
the application of technology and
scientific principles to the
planning, functional design,
operation and management of
facilities for any mode of
transportation in order to provide
the safe, rapid, comfortable,
convenient, economical, and
environmentally compatible
movement of people and goods

A

Transportation
Engineering

11
Q

Data Needed for Transportation Modelling
and Forecasting

A
  1. Population
  2. Land use
  3. Transportation facilities and services
  4. Economic activity
  5. Travel patterns and volumes
  6. Regional financial resources
  7. Community values and expectations
  8. Laws and ordinances

14
Q

Most notable urban transport problems

A
  1. Traffic congestion and parking difficulties
  2. Longer commuting
  3. Public transport inadequacy
  4. Difficulties for non-motorized transport
  5. Loss of Public Space
